PURPOSE: To obtain a narrow band frequency discrimination circuit transmitting only a frequency signal being an odd number of times of the sampling frequency by supplying an input signal having a frequency band including a signal being an odd number of times of the sampling frequency.
CONSTITUTION: A signal at an input terminal is fed to a switched capacitor filter operated according to the sampling signal set to a frequency being 1/(2N+1) of the specific frequency included in the signal frequency band so as to send the specific frequency signal having an odd number (2N+1) times of the frequency of the sampling signal. For example, an input signal Vin is fed to one electrode of an input capacitor CI via a switch means SI and the other electrode is coupled with an inversed input terminal (-) of an operational amplifier circuit OP. A feedback capacitor Cf is provided between the inversed input terminal (-) and an output terminal of the operational amplifier OP. Further, a capacitor C2 whose one electrode is connected to a ground potential and whose other electrode is connected laternately to the inverting input (-) and the output terminal of the operational amplifier circuit OP via a changeover switch means S2 is provided.
